Scleria pauciflora Muhlenberg ex Willdenow var. pauciflora . Papillose Nutrush. Phen: Jun-Sep. Hab: Wet to dry pine flatwoods, pine savannas, depression meadows. Dist: NJ west to KS, south to FL and TX; Cuba.

Origin/Endemic status: Native

Taxonomy Comments: Typification of S. pauciflora is controversial and unresolved at this time (Fairey & Whittemore 1999).

Synonymy: = Ar, FNA23, G, GrPl, Il, K1, K3, K4, Mi, NE, Tn, Va, Fairey (1967), LeBlond, Tessel, & Poindexter (2015); < Scleria ciliata Michx. – WH3; < Scleria pauciflora Muhl. ex Willd. – C, ETx1, GW1, Mo1, Pa, RAB, S, Tx, W; > Scleria pauciflora Muhl. ex Willd. var. kansana Fernald – F; > Scleria pauciflora Muhl. ex Willd. var. pauciflora – F
